Plant protection products
Critically examined - plant protection products
The BVL is responsible for authorising plant protection products in Germany. In this process, the BVL is responsible for risk management, i.e. for authorisation decisions and administrative measures to protect both humans and the environment. Furthermore, the BVL acts as the national coordination point in the European cooperation to evaluate active substances in plant protection products and to determine maximum residue levels. It lists plant resistance improvers and adjuvants which are permitted in Germany.

Domestic sales and export of plant protection products
Producers and distributors of plant protection products are legally obliged to report sales and exports to the BVL. The BVL releases annual statistic reports.
